As expected it was a high scoring game between the Stampeders and Alouettes. Two of the best QB in the CFL did not disappoint their fans. Burris passed for 26/42 with 422 yards run for 1 TD and tossed 3 TD passes (2 for Forzani and 1 for Rambo). Calvillo 28/49 369 yards and tossed for 3 TDs but threw 1 INT late in the game. It was pretty much mistakes-free for both QB.
Three receivers for Stampeders caught over 100 yards. Johnnie Forzani had a monster game. He caught 6 passes for 101 yards and 2 TDs, Nik "Geronimo" Lewis also had a monster game caught 7 for 121 yards and Ken-Yon Rambo 5/111 1 TD.
Defense made some adjustments in the 2nd half and did a good job stopping Calvillo especially in the 3rd quarter. Calvillo targeted LB Brandon Isaac early in the game matching against Jamel Richardson. We didn't really see Calvillo throwing the ball against Brandon Smith, Greg Fassit or Geoff Tisdale much. It was mostly against Isaac and Raymond. Overall, the defense just did enough to help the Stamps win the game.
